Identification of Glow-in-the-Dark Mushrooms: Learn to recognize bioluminescent fungi species
To identify glow-in-the-dark mushrooms, one must first understand the concept of bioluminescence. Bioluminescence is the production and emission of light by a living organism, and in the case of mushrooms, it is typically caused by a chemical reaction within the fungi's cells. This phenomenon is relatively rare in the fungal kingdom, with only a handful of species known to exhibit bioluminescence.
One of the most well-known bioluminescent mushrooms is the "Jack O'Lantern" mushroom (Omphalotus olearius). This species is characterized by its bright orange cap and gills that emit a greenish glow in the dark. Another example is the "Foxfire" fungus (Panellus stipticus), which produces a blue-green light. It's important to note that while these mushrooms may look fascinating, not all bioluminescent fungi are edible, and some can be toxic.
When attempting to identify glow-in-the-dark mushrooms, it's crucial to consider the habitat in which they are found. Bioluminescent mushrooms typically grow in forested areas, often on decaying wood or in leaf litter. They are more commonly found in tropical and subtropical regions, although some species can be found in temperate climates as well.
To safely identify and potentially harvest glow-in-the-dark mushrooms, it's recommended to consult with a local mycologist or join a guided foraging tour. These experts can provide valuable insights into the specific species found in your area and help you avoid potentially dangerous look-alikes. Remember, it's always better to err on the side of caution when it comes to wild mushroom foraging, as misidentification can lead to serious health consequences.

Legal and Ethical Considerations: Navigate the regulations and ethical guidelines surrounding the foraging and consumption of wild mushrooms
Foraging for wild mushrooms, including those that glow in the dark, is subject to a complex web of legal and ethical considerations. While some species of bioluminescent mushrooms are indeed edible, the legality of harvesting them can vary significantly depending on the jurisdiction. In many regions, foraging for wild mushrooms is regulated by local laws and guidelines, which may restrict the types of mushrooms that can be collected, the quantities allowed, and the methods of harvesting.
Ethical considerations also play a crucial role in the foraging of wild mushrooms. It is essential to respect the natural environment and ensure that foraging activities do not harm the ecosystem. This includes avoiding over-harvesting, which can deplete mushroom populations and disrupt the balance of the forest floor. Additionally, foragers should be mindful of the potential impact of their activities on other species, such as insects and animals, that rely on mushrooms as a food source.
In some cases, the foraging of wild mushrooms may also be subject to ethical guidelines set forth by indigenous communities or other cultural groups. These guidelines may restrict access to certain areas or species, and it is important to respect these traditions and cultural practices.
When considering the legality and ethics of foraging for glow-in-the-dark mushrooms, it is also important to be aware of the potential risks associated with consuming wild mushrooms. Misidentification can lead to poisoning, and even edible species can cause adverse reactions in some individuals. Therefore, it is crucial to have a thorough understanding of mushroom identification and to consult with experts before consuming any wild mushrooms.
In conclusion, navigating the legal and ethical considerations surrounding the foraging and consumption of wild mushrooms, including those that glow in the dark, requires a careful and informed approach. By respecting local laws, ethical guidelines, and the natural environment, foragers can enjoy the unique beauty and culinary delights of wild mushrooms while minimizing the risks and potential harm to the ecosystem.
